Mechanical Engineering Jobs

Mechanical engineering is a broad field with diverse career opportunities. In 2023, some of the most in-demand mechanical engineering jobs will include roles in manufacturing, robotics, and aerospace. With advancements in automation and the rise of Industry 4.0, mechanical engineers will be critical in developing and designing new technologies.

Process Engineering Jobs

Process engineers play a critical role in improving efficiency and reducing costs in manufacturing and production. In 2023, the demand for process engineering jobs will continue to grow, with particular emphasis on renewable energy, food and beverage, and pharmaceuticals. This growth is driven by a need for sustainable and efficient production processes.

Quality Engineering Jobs

Quality engineering plays a crucial role in ensuring the safety, reliability, and quality of products and services. In 2023, the demand for quality engineering jobs will remain high, with a particular emphasis on software, medical devices, and consumer goods. As companies continue to prioritize customer satisfaction and regulatory compliance, quality engineering will be an essential field to watch.
